The more Dele gets criticised for diving (whether the criticism is justified or not), the more refs assume he's diving, even if he's been genuinely fouled. The reputation he's gaining now will see us being denied nailed-on penalties at key moments of key games somewhere down the line, so the criticism isn't exactly 'irrelevant'. It's one part of his game that definitely needs to be straightened out.
